2. Bitcoin Mining: A Fundamental Process
At its core, Bitcoin mining is the process through which new Bitcoins are created and transactions are added to the blockchain, a decentralized and immutable ledger. Miners validate and record these transactions using powerful computers that solve complex mathematical puzzles.

6. Technical Advancements
The field of Bitcoin mining has seen remarkable advancements in hardware and software. From the early days of CPU mining to the current era of Application-Specific Integrated Circuits (ASICs), technological innovation continues to drive efficiency and profitability in mining operations.

9. Bitcoin Mining Pools
To increase their chances of earning rewards, many miners join mining pools, where they combine their computational power. This collaborative approach ensures more consistent payouts for participants.

13. The Halving Event
Bitcoin experiences a halving event approximately every four years, reducing the reward miners receive. This event plays a crucial role in controlling the supply of new Bitcoins, making them scarcer over time.
